ZIP Code 17214 is a 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Franklin County, Pennsylvania, home to about 1,162 residents. At $58,750, its median household income sits below Franklin County's $74,946.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 17214's population grew 41.9% from 819 to 1,162, while its median gross rent rose 29.9% from $648 to $842.
White (non-Hispanic) residents are the largest group, 92.5% of the population. 65.1% of workers drive to work alone.
